Recap: Alta Hawks vs. West Jordan Jaguars
The Alta Hawks put another one in the bag on Tuesday to keep their perfect season alive. They blew past West Jordan 72-50. Alta might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team's won three contests by 22 points or more this season.
Alta got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Jaxon Johnson out in front who almost dropped a triple-double on 17 points, 12 rebounds, and nine assists. Those nine assists set a new season-high mark for Johnson. Ace Reiser was another key contributor, scoring 16 points along with eight rebounds and five assists.
Alta's victory bumped their record up to 6-0. As for West Jordan, their defeat was their tenth straight at home dating back to last season, which bumped their record down to 0-6.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Alta will be home for the holidays to greet Woods Cross at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Woods Cross will have to bring their A-game into this one, as they are staring down a pretty big deficit in the MaxPreps Utah Rankings (they are ranked 114th, while Alta is ranked second). West Jordan will be home for the holidays to greet Skyridge at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
